From the garage to the roof deck, every inch of this amenity-filled home is designed to dazzle. This home’s classic design style mixes perfectly with traditional & transitional elements to return this landmark property to its original beauty with modern finishes.
On the parlor level, enter to find a bright living room featuring a fully-restored fireplace. Heading toward the back of this home, find a separate sitting area with pocket doors leading to the kitchen. This state-of-the-art kitchen boasts a full suite of professional-grade appliances, including a Bertazzoni gas range + hood, Summit wine cooler, & Subzero refrigerator. You’ll be delighted to find a washer + dryer & powder room off the kitchen & an additional living room at the rear of this floor.
The garden level offers a recreation room, a full wet bar, & a bedroom with an en-suite bath. An exterior garden level areaway leads to the garage boasting a Tesla charging station.
The second floor is taken over by an impressive floor-through bedroom suite featuring a large bedroom with a sitting area. The back sitting area can also act as a library, study or an additional bedroom. Here, escape to your private terrace for outdoor relaxation. The magnificent bath features marble-tiled heated flooring, double vanity, & a sit-in glass-enclosed shower.
The third floor is dedicated to two more bedrooms each with en-suite bathrooms & spacious closets. Abundant windows let light flood these rooms all day long. Travel upstairs one last time to the crowning gem of this home… a glass skybox leading to a roof deck providing expansive views of the surrounding Striver’s Row Historic District.
Located near the A, B, C, 2, & 3 lines, and several major bus routes, commuting has never been easier. Nearby, you’ll also find St. Nicholas Park for outdoor fun.
